Healthy Whole Wheat Pancakes With A Tropical Twist
Total Time: 15 mins
Preparation Time: 5 mins
Cook Time: 10 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1 1/4 whole wheat flour
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 egg
- 1 1/2 cups coconut milk (more if you like thinner pancakes)
- 1 1/2 tablespoons s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 ripe banana, mashed
- coconut oil
- powdered sugar
- fresh raspberry (or your choice of fresh berries)
- real maple syrup
Recipe
- 1 sift flour and baking powder together into a bowl; set aside.
- 2 combine egg, coconut milk, sugar, vanilla, and salt in a medium bowl.
- 3 stir flour into milk mixture; add in mashed banana.
- 4 heat skillet over medium heat using coconut oil to grease pan.
- 5 cook pancakes until desired doneness, or until batter begins to bubble (about 2-3 minutes per side depending on size of pancake).
- 6 sprinkle pancakes with powdered sugar, top with choice of fresh berries.
- 7 serve with real maple syrup.
